JSP连接SQL数据库:必知的服务器权限要点
jsp接sql时数据库的服务器权限吗

首页 2024-10-01 08:45:17



JSP连接SQL Server数据库:确保服务器权限的正确配置 在当今的信息化时代,Web应用程序的开发与数据库的连接已成为不可或缺的一环

    JSP(Java Server Pages)作为Java EE标准的一部分,广泛应用于企业级Web应用的开发中

    当JSP需要与SQL Server数据库进行交互时,确保服务器权限的正确配置是确保数据安全和高效访问的关键

    本文将从技术角度深入探讨JSP连接SQL Server数据库时,如何确保服务器权限的正确设置

     一、理解数据库连接的基本需求 在JSP连接SQL Server数据库之前,首先需要明确数据库服务器的访问权限设置

    这包括数据库的登录验证模式、用户权限分配以及网络配置等方面

    SQL Server提供了两种身份验证模式:Windows身份验证模式和SQL Server身份验证模式

    对于跨平台的JSP应用,通常建议使用SQL Server身份验证模式,因为它不依赖于Windows域环境,更加灵活

     二、配置SQL Server身份验证模式 1.打开SQL Server Management Studio(SSMS):首先,需要确保SQL Server服务正在运行,并使用SSMS连接到数据库实例

     2.修改身份验证模式:在数据库引擎的属性中,选择“安全性”页签,将身份验证模式设置为“SQL Server和Windows身份验证模式”

    这一步骤确保了JSP应用可以通过用户名和密码来访问数据库

     3.启用并配置sa账户:sa是SQL Server的超级用户账户,默认拥有最高权限

    为了确保JSP应用能够成功连接,需要启用`sa`账户,并为其设置一个强密码

    同时,在账户属性中确保“登录”状态为“启用”,并勾选“允许连接到数据库引擎”

     三、配置网络协议 JSP应用通过JDBC(Java Database Connectivity)与SQL Server数据库进行通信,这要求数据库服务器支持相应的网络协议

     1.启用TCP/IP协议:在SQL Server Configuration Manager中,打开SQL Server网络配置,找到对应的SQL Server实例(如`SQLEXPRESS`),确保TCP/IP协议已启用

    如果需要

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密